17th and Vine is no more

17th and Vine, a mid rise condominium project in Henderson is no more.  The project has been dragging its feet for the last year, claiming it was going forward despite very little construction activity.   The project was adjacent to RJ Wiley on Stephanie.

Originally the project was advertised all over the valley and was not cooperating with local realtors. As the condo market started to cool, the project owners decided to re-think their marketing strategy and solicited the Las Vegas realtor community to help with the project. Sales picked up and some construction was done. The site was cleared and prepped for a foundation....then nothing.

Now, the project has been re-named Stephanie Village. There is no word from the new project as to design or options, although from the render on their site it seems that the project will be changing very little. Time will tell. -Charles
